On October 12, 2021, Rivers revealed on his [[Mister Rivers' Neighborhood|Discord server]] that he was intending for "Records" to be released as the lead single for SZNZ: Summer.<ref>Rivers Cuomo. ''Discord''. 12 October 2021. Screenshot: [[:File:Mrn-discord-10-12-2021.png]]</ref> Rivers claimed that the song would be released on the same day as ''[[SZNZ: Spring]]'', but for unknown reasons, this did not happen.
